Specification | Sony Ericsson Xperia Neo | Xiaomi Redmi Y2 |
---|---|---|
Internal Memory | 320 MB | 32 GB |
RAM | 512 MB | 3 GB |
Display | 3.7 inches, 480 x 854 pixels | 5.99 inches, 720 x 1440 pixels |
OS | Android v2.3 (Gingerbread) | Android v8.1 (Oreo), upgradable to v9.0 (Pie) |
Rear Camera | 8.1 MP with autofocus | 12 MP f/2.2 (Main)<br>5 MP (Depth Sensor) with autofocus |
Price | ₹16,194 | ₹8,599 |
